Introduction

The BCM68380IFSBG is a System on Chip ( SoC ) used in various networking devices, typically in routers and gateways. When encountering memory issues with the BCM68380IFSBG, it's crucial to identify the root cause to resolve the problem effectively. Memory issues can manifest in various forms such as crashes, slow performance, or errors related to memory allocation and Access .

Common Causes of Memory Issues Outdated Firmware: The chip might be running on outdated firmware, causing incompatibilities with memory handling and management functions. Hardware Defects: Physical damage or defects in the chip's memory controller or memory module s may cause instability. Excessive Memory Usage: If the system is running applications that consume too much memory or if memory allocation is poorly managed, this can lead to memory issues. Incorrect Memory Configuration: Incorrect BIOS or U-Boot settings, such as memory timing or overclocking, can lead to instability. Corrupted Memory: In rare cases, memory regions can become corrupted due to improper shutdowns or software errors. Steps to Troubleshoot and Fix Memory Issues

Follow these steps to identify and fix memory-related issues in the BCM68380IFSBG:

Step 1: Check for Firmware Updates

Reason: Outdated firmware can cause memory management issues and bugs that affect chip performance. Action: Visit the manufacturer's website or the device’s support page to check if a firmware update is available. Download and install the latest firmware that is compatible with your device. Follow the instructions for updating firmware carefully, as improper updates may lead to additional issues. After the update, restart the device and check if the memory issue is resolved.

Step 2: Perform a Hard Reset

Reason: In some cases, memory issues are caused by temporary system instability or configuration errors that can be cleared through a reset. Action: Turn off the device completely. Press and hold the reset button for about 10 seconds (this may vary depending on the device). Release the reset button and wait for the device to reboot. After the reboot, check if the memory issue persists.

Step 3: Check Hardware for Defects

Reason: If there’s a hardware failure in the memory components of the BCM68380IFSBG, it can cause memory errors. Action: Inspect the device for any visible signs of damage, especially around the memory areas. Run a diagnostic test (if available) to check for hardware faults. This test is often built into the device's firmware or provided by the manufacturer. If you suspect hardware damage, contact the manufacturer for repair or replacement.

Step 4: Monitor Memory Usage

Reason: Excessive memory usage by applications or services can lead to slow performance and crashes. Action: Access the device’s system settings or use a network monitoring tool to track memory usage over time. Identify processes that are consuming unusually high amounts of memory. If certain applications are responsible for high memory usage, try disabling or updating them to more memory-efficient versions.

Step 5: Verify Memory Configuration

Reason: Incorrect memory configuration, such as improper settings in the BIOS or U-Boot, can cause memory instability. Action: Access the system’s BIOS or U-Boot settings during the boot process. Look for settings related to memory configuration, including memory timings, frequency, and voltage. Ensure the settings are set to default or recommended values. If you’ve been overclocking the system, revert the settings to their default values to avoid pushing the memory beyond its capability.

Step 6: Reinstall the Operating System

Reason: If software corruption or improper configurations are causing memory issues, reinstalling the operating system can resolve the issue. Action: Backup all important data from the device to ensure you don’t lose any important files. Reinstall the operating system, either by downloading the latest version from the manufacturer or by using a recovery partition. After reinstalling, monitor the device to see if the memory issue is resolved.

Step 7: Use Memory Diagnostic Tools

Reason: Memory corruption can occur due to software errors or unexpected power loss. Action: Use memory diagnostic tools such as MemTest86 or other tools that support the BCM68380IFSBG chipset. Run a memory test to check for any errors or bad sectors in the memory. If errors are found, you may need to replace the faulty memory module or contact the manufacturer for further support. Final Notes Regular Maintenance: Keeping firmware up-to-date and monitoring system performance can help prevent memory issues in the future. Seek Manufacturer Support: If none of the steps resolve the issue, contacting the manufacturer for assistance is recommended, especially if the chip is still under warranty.

By following these troubleshooting steps, you should be able to resolve most memory-related issues with the BCM68380IFSBG chip. Ensure regular updates and monitor system performance to avoid encountering similar problems in the future.
